服务器数据库不见了,这对于任何企业或个人来说都是一个紧急且严重的问题,在这种情况下,冷静分析原因、采取正确的恢复措施至关重要,以下是一篇详细的文章,旨在帮助读者了解数据库丢失的可能原因、恢复方法以及预防措施。

数据库丢失的可能原因
硬件故障
硬件故障是导致数据库丢失的常见原因之一,硬盘损坏、内存故障或电源问题都可能导致数据库文件损坏或丢失。
软件错误
软件错误,如操作系统崩溃、数据库管理系统(DBMS)故障或应用程序错误,也可能导致数据库数据丢失。
人为错误
人为错误,如误删除、不正确的数据库操作或备份策略不当,也是数据库丢失的主要原因。
网络攻击
网络攻击,如黑客入侵、恶意软件或DDoS攻击,可能导致数据库被篡改或完全丢失。
数据库恢复方法
检查备份
检查是否有最新的数据库备份,如果备份可用,可以使用备份文件恢复数据库。

| 步骤 | 说明 |
|---|---|
| 1 | 确认备份文件的存在和完整性 |
| 2 | 根据备份文件的类型,使用相应的恢复工具或命令恢复数据库 |
| 3 | 验证恢复后的数据库是否正常工作 |
使用数据恢复工具
如果备份不可用,可以尝试使用数据恢复工具来恢复丢失的数据。
| 工具 | 说明 |
|---|---|
| CoolRecovery | 一款强大的数据恢复软件,支持多种文件系统的恢复 |
| kd.cn的云数据库恢复服务 | 针对云数据库的恢复服务,提供快速、高效的数据恢复解决方案 |
重建数据库
如果以上方法都无法恢复数据,可能需要重建数据库。
| 步骤 | 说明 |
|---|---|
| 1 | 收集所有可用数据,包括日志文件、配置文件等 |
| 2 | 使用DBMS提供的工具或命令重建数据库结构 |
| 3 | 将收集到的数据导入新数据库 |
预防措施
定期备份
定期备份是防止数据库丢失的关键措施,建议使用自动化备份工具,确保备份的及时性和完整性。
硬件维护
定期检查硬件设备,确保其正常运行,对于关键硬件,可以考虑使用冗余配置。
安全防护
加强网络安全防护,防止网络攻击和数据泄露。

经验案例:酷盾(kd.cn)云数据库恢复服务
某企业使用酷盾(kd.cn)的云数据库服务,在一次服务器故障后,数据库数据丢失,在紧急情况下,企业使用了酷盾(kd.cn)的云数据库恢复服务,成功恢复了丢失的数据,该服务通过专业的技术团队和高效的恢复流程,为企业节省了大量时间和成本。
FAQs
Q1:如果数据库丢失,我应该如何快速恢复数据?
A1:首先检查是否有最新的数据库备份,如果备份可用,使用备份文件恢复数据库,如果备份不可用,尝试使用数据恢复工具或联系专业数据恢复服务。
Q2:如何预防数据库丢失?
A2:定期备份数据库,加强硬件维护,提高网络安全防护,以及制定合理的备份策略是预防数据库丢失的有效措施。
文献权威来源
- 《数据库系统原理与应用》,作者:张宇,出版社:清华大学出版社。
- 《网络安全技术》,作者:李晓东,出版社:人民邮电出版社。
原创文章,发布者:酷盾叔,转转请注明出处:https://www.kd.cn/ask/431627.html